What is the Magnolia Pediatric Therapy Privacy Practices Consent?
The Magnolia Pediatric Therapy Privacy Practices Consent form is essential in the healthcare sector, enabling healthcare providers to obtain patient consent for the use and disclosure of health information. It serves a critical role in establishing transparency in how health data is leveraged for treatment, payment, and healthcare operations.
This consent form outlines patient rights regarding their sensitive information and requires a signature for acknowledgment. By signing, patients confirm their understanding of how their health information may be utilized.

Who is required to sign the Magnolia Pediatric Therapy Privacy Practices Consent?
The patient or their legal guardian must sign the Magnolia Pediatric Therapy Privacy Practices Consent to acknowledge understanding and provide consent for the use of their health information.
